Understanding EDRSilencer: A Tool for Evasion and Its Implications for Cybersecurity
In the ever-evolving landscape of cybersecurity, the tactics employed by threat actors are becoming increasingly sophisticated. Recently, the open-source tool EDRSilencer has garnered attention for its potential misuse in bypassing Endpoint Detection and Response (EDR) solutions. Developed as a means to tamper with these security measures, EDRSilencer has been identified by Trend Micro as a tool that malicious actors are actively integrating into their attack strategies. This article delves into what EDRSilencer is, how it operates, and the underlying principles that make it a significant concern for cybersecurity professionals.
The Rise of EDR Solutions
To appreciate the implications of EDRSilencer, it’s essential to understand the role of EDR solutions in cybersecurity. EDR systems are designed to monitor endpoint devices—such as laptops, servers, and mobile devices—for suspicious activities. They provide real-time detection, investigation, and response capabilities to threats, making them a pivotal component of an organization’s security posture. However, as EDR technology advances, so do the techniques employed by cybercriminals to circumvent these defenses.
This is where EDRSilencer comes into play. Inspired by the NightHawk FireBlock tool from MDSec, EDRSilencer was initially designed to disable EDR solutions in authorized environments, primarily for security testing and research purposes. However, its open-source nature makes it accessible to anyone, including those with malicious intent.
Mechanisms of EDRSilencer
EDRSilencer operates by manipulating the processes and services associated with EDR software. Here’s how it generally works in practice:
1. Process Injection: EDRSilencer can inject code into the processes of the EDR software itself. By doing so, it can alter the behavior of these processes, effectively rendering them blind to the malicious activities taking place on the endpoint.
2. Service Manipulation: The tool can stop or disable EDR services entirely. This prevents the EDR from collecting data on malicious actions, allowing attackers to operate without detection.
3. Log Tampering: EDRSilencer can also manipulate the logging mechanisms of EDR solutions. It may erase or alter logs that would typically record indicators of compromise, further obscuring the attackers' activities.
By employing these tactics, threat actors can maintain persistence within a compromised environment, execute their malicious payloads, and exfiltrate data without raising alarms.
Underlying Principles of EDRSilencer's Operation
The effectiveness of EDRSilencer stems from several core principles of cybersecurity and software operation:
- Privilege Escalation: Many EDR solutions operate with high privileges, allowing them to monitor and manage system-level activities. EDRSilencer exploits this by targeting these privileged processes, thereby gaining control over the EDR’s functionalities.
- Visibility Reduction: One of the fundamental goals of any evasion technique is to reduce visibility. EDRSilencer achieves this by manipulating the monitoring capabilities of the EDR, effectively blinding it to ongoing threats.
- Use of Open-Source Tools: The rise of open-source software has democratized access to powerful tools. While this can be beneficial for security researchers, it also means that malicious actors can easily leverage these tools to craft sophisticated attacks.
Implications for Cybersecurity
The emergence of EDRSilencer and similar tools poses significant challenges for cybersecurity professionals. As attackers become more adept at disabling security measures, organizations must adopt more proactive and layered security strategies. This includes:
- Behavioral Analysis: Instead of relying solely on signature-based detection, organizations should implement behavioral analysis techniques that can identify anomalies in system behavior, even if EDR systems are tampered with.
- Regular Updates and Patching: Keeping EDR systems and other security tools up to date is crucial. Regular updates can help mitigate vulnerabilities that may be exploited by tools like EDRSilencer.
- Incident Response Planning: Organizations should develop and regularly update incident response plans that account for potential EDR bypass techniques. This includes training staff to recognize signs of tampering and having protocols in place for rapid response.
In conclusion, while EDRSilencer presents a significant challenge in the fight against cybercrime, understanding its mechanisms and underlying principles is crucial for developing effective countermeasures. As cyber threats continue to evolve, staying informed and prepared is the best defense against malicious activities that seek to exploit vulnerabilities in our security frameworks.